Preliminary results on new CCD photometry inV andB bands of approximately 5000 stars in four overlapping fields in the globular cluster M3 are presented. The colour-magnitude diagram shows a very well-defined sequence with a small scatter, going fainter than previously published work on this cluster. The turn-off point found atV=19.1±0.2 mag and (B-V)=0.445±0.01, is slightly redder than those obtained in previous studies.
